

KACE Cloud and Windows Autopilot compete in endpoint management solutions. KACE Cloud has an advantage in support and pricing, while Windows Autopilot offers advanced features for those willing to make a larger investment.
Features: KACE Cloud focuses on management and patching, offering an all-in-one solution with ease of integration. Some of its strengths include comprehensive management, straightforward self-service deployment, and responsive support. Windows Autopilot emphasizes on device provisioning, with sophisticated automation features and streamlined setup for Windows devices.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Windows Autopilot ensures streamlined deployment with detailed documentation and proactive Microsoft support, making deployment seamless. KACE Cloud simplifies everything with a straightforward self-service deployment and is supported by responsive service, ideal for businesses needing quick resolutions.
Pricing and ROI: KACE Cloud stands out with its competitive pricing, offering quick ROI through a cost-effective setup. Windows Autopilot, requiring a higher initial investment, justifies this with extensive capabilities and offers long-term savings in management efficiency. The choice between them depends on budget constraints versus operational benefits.

KACE Cloud is an asset management and endpoint management service that streamlines IT operations for businesses, providing a scalable solution that ensures efficient management of devices and software from a single interface.
Designed for businesses seeking to enhance their IT management, KACE Cloud offers comprehensive features for device management, software distribution, and inventory tracking, helping organizations manage IT resources effectively. This enhances workforce productivity by allowing IT teams to monitor and deploy software across multiple devices from anywhere. In addition, KACE Cloud provides efficient mobile device management, securing and managing mobile devices within the enterprise setting, and reducing downtime in IT operations.

Windows Autopilot streamlines device deployment with automated domain joining and fast configuration. It simplifies the setup process, significantly reducing time while ensuring consistent results, particularly beneficial for managing multiple devices efficiently.
Windows Autopilot enhances device management by offering seamless automatic enrollment and configuration. Its automation capabilities simplify setup with self-deploying features for shared devices and automated policy compliance like antivirus updates. By using configuration files, it supports bulk device setup, accelerating the deployment process and reducing time from hours to minutes. AI integration further enhances cloud-based setup and deployment, optimizing the management of a large number of devices. Users can enroll devices in Intune and configure them using their serial number, adhering to company policies for streamlined processes.
